XLS & XML Conversion
You can convert older Microsoft Excel (XLS) spreadsheets to eXtensible Markup Language (XML). Converting to XML makes data more precise when processed by a wide variety of machines, as well as allowing for target retrieval and making documents more accessible, according to XML.gov.

Use Excel 2007 or 2010
-
Starting with Office 2007, you can save Excel spreadsheets in XML by saving the file as an XML Data file. Open the spreadsheet in Excel 2010, then click "Microsoft Office" button and click "Save As." In the Print dialog box, click the "Save as Type" menu and select "XML Data."
Online Conversion
-
Use free, online file converters such as Zamzar to change Excel spreadsheets to XML pages. Upload the file to the file conversion server and download the converted file several hours later.

Software Conversion
-
You can find free or trial versions of software to transform XLS to XML. Navigate to the site and download programs such as Convert XLS, Advanced XLS Converter or Excel Export to Multiple XML Files Software to convert your document. Once one of these applications is installed, you can convert as many files as you need.
